Danelle (Nellie) Ballengee is best known as a member of the Nike ACG/Balance Bar adventure racing team, but she also excels at skyrunning (high-altitude cross-country), snowshoeing and mountain climbing. On July 17 the 33-year-old from Dillon, Colo., and her three teammates will defend their title at the Balance Bar 24-hour event in Beaver Creek, Colo. Here's what Ballengee will pack.
...CRAMPONS
Kahtoola KTS
The nice thing about these versus other mountaineering crampons is that the middle band is flexible for strapping them onto a running shoe. The claws face down instead of forward like an ice-climbing crampon, which allows our team to run without snagging the toepiece. With these on we can really fly across glaciers and snowfields...
